The digital workplace, intranet and digital employee experience – Johan explains the concepts

Many concepts – same meaning? Or do they? Our digital workplace advisor Johan Nilsson explains the difference between intranet, digital workplace and digital employee experience. And how should they work together? Johan knows!

The intranet – a look back

Since the beginning, the intranet has been fighting an uphill battle. It is constantly questioned and has always needed to justify its existence while we have welcomed the digital workplace and digital employee experience players with open arms.

We also see that management has historically had a lack of interest in the intranet as only a few organisations report to management. According to the trend report "How is Sweden's intranet doing in 2024?", only 18% regularly inform management about how they are doing against the set goals.

Intranet, digital workplace and digital employee experience – a mixed bag?

How do all these concepts fit together, really? Let's take a closer look at them:

The intranet

The intranet has always been the digital home of an organization's internal communication – for both content and channels. Even though we've covered different types of intranets such as top-down intranets and social intranets, nothing has really changed: the intranet continues to play an important role in today's modern organisations.

In recent years, the intranet has increasingly taken on the role of a digital doorway to organisations' other information sources and tools. Never before has the intranet been more closely linked to various business systems and collaboration tools.

"Do we really need an intranet?". Our daily work is not just about digital collaboration – to maintain high quality, we need to rely on information that lives in processes, policies and governance documents. This is information that you can't ask a colleague for the answer to – you need to be able to find it on the intranet. That's why the intranet is a mission-critical system that should serve you with the answers to the 500 most frequently asked questions. And you don't want to find this information in a file structure in Sharepoint or in OneDrive – no, this should be done through a user-friendly experience on an intranet.

Many of today's intranets also have the vision of being a one-stop-shop – the platform that all employees use in their daily work.

The digital workplace

The digital workplace is actually older than the intranet because it consists of an organisation's collective digital tools. The intranet is one of those tools – just like Office 365, Google Workspace and Salesforce.

We often talk about the digital workplace from a holistic perspective. It consists of a set of tools, platforms and work environments that are delivered together, thus increasing efficiency.

The digital workplace also wants to be a one-stop-shop, which is a good option if you work a lot in Office 365 or Google Workspace, for example.

Digital employee experience (DEX)

Digital employee experience is about the employee's digital journey through the workday – where they get information and how they perform their tasks. It is also about the interaction between employees and the digital opportunities and conditions offered by the organisation.

The focus of digital employee experience is to create a shared digital experience. The design and content must be consistent so that the experience is the same wherever the employee is. It is also based on a holistic perspective where, among other things, HR is an important part as the work is also about interaction between employees.

How does it all fit together?

First of all, all these tools and perspectives should coexist and not compete with each other. Digital employee experience is a concept that brings harmony to an employee's digital life and gives context to different tools and tasks.

Organisations are often good at acquiring new digital tools and this can lead to complex digital workplaces. The tools themselves can be great, but the overall complexity can have a devastating effect. That's why it's super important to integrate and adapt all tools to the digital workplace.

Also, avoid 'silo' visions of the intranet and the digital workplace as both vendors and product owners often strive to be the platform that brings all tools and information together – the one-stop-shop.

So, anyone who wants to equip for a modern organisation needs to make the concepts of intranet, digital workplace and digital employee experience coexist.
